MySQL查询最近一月数据
时间: 2024-01-04 19:03:42 浏览: 179
mysql 查询当天、本周,本月,上一个月的数据
在MySQL中查询最近一个月的数据,可以使用DATE_SUB()函数和CURDATE()函数结合使用。DATE_SUB()函数可以用来计算日期的加减操作,CURDATE()函数可以获取当前日期。以下是查询最近一个月数据的SQL语句示例:
```
SELECT * FROM 表名 WHERE 日期字段 >= DATE_SUB(CURDATE(), INTERVAL 1 MONTH);
```
其中,表名是要查询的表的名称,日期字段是要查询的日期字段的名称。在查询时,筛选出日期字段大于等于当前日期减去一个月的数据。
如果要按照日期字段进行排序,可以在SQL语句末尾添加ORDER BY 日期字段 DESC,表示按照日期字段倒序排列。完整的SQL语句示例如下:
```
SELECT * FROM 表名 WHERE 日期字段 >= DATE_SUB(CURDATE(), INTERVAL 1 MONTH) ORDER BY 日期字段 DESC;
```
这样就能查询到最近一个月的数据,并按照日期字段倒序排列。
阅读全文